Bruton’s tyrosine kinase (BTK) is indispensable in Neutrophils to initiate and maintain Skin Inflammation in a Model of Pemphigoid Diseases

2025-02-13

Abstract excerpt

Bruton’s tyrosine kinase (BTK) is essential for B cell functions. Its role in myeloid cells is less understood. More insights into its significance in myeloid cells are required to evaluate its potential as therapeutic target in the effector phase of antibody-induced autoimmune diseases when inhibiting the production of autoantibodies can suppress tissue inflammation only time delayed.
